resistance

//rɪˈzɪstəns//
B2Frequency Level 7Neutral
Visual representation of resistance

Noun

resistanceSingular
resistancesPlural
1

The act of opposing or fighting against something or someone.

The protesters showed strong resistance to the new law.

2

The ability to withstand or not be affected by something, especially a disease or harmful substance.

Regular exercise can help build resistance to disease.

3

A force that opposes or slows down motion or movement.

Air resistance slows down the falling object.

4

The opposition of a material or device to the flow of electric current, measured in ohms.

The resistance of this wire is measured in ohms.

5

An organized group fighting against an occupying force or government.

The resistance fought bravely against the occupying army.
